BS 9991, also known as “Recommendations for fire safety in the design, management, and use of residential buildings – Code of practice,” is a British Standard that provides guidance on fire safety in residential buildings. It was first introduced in 2015 and has since been updated to ensure that buildings are designed and maintained with the utmost consideration for fire safety.
The purpose of BS 9991 is to establish a set of recommendations that can be used by architects, designers, developers, and building owners to achieve an acceptable level of fire safety in residential buildings. It covers a wide range of topics, including means of escape, fire detection and alarm systems, fire suppression systems, and fire resistance of structural elements. By following the guidelines set out in BS 9991, stakeholders can ensure that the risk of fire in residential buildings is minimized, and that occupants can safely evacuate in the event of an emergency.
One of the key aspects of BS 9991 is the focus on prevention and early detection of fires. The standard recommends the use of fire-resistant materials in the construction of buildings, as well as the installation of smoke alarms and fire detection systems. By incorporating these measures into the design and construction of residential buildings, stakeholders can reduce the likelihood of a fire occurring and increase the chances of early detection if one does occur.
BS 9991 also includes recommendations for means of escape in the event of a fire. This includes guidance on the design and layout of escape routes, as well as the provision of signage and lighting to ensure that occupants can safely evacuate the building. By following these recommendations, stakeholders can ensure that occupants have a clear and unobstructed path to safety in the event of an emergency.
In addition to prevention and means of escape, BS 9991 also addresses the importance of fire suppression systems in residential buildings. The standard recommends the installation of sprinkler systems and other fire suppression measures to help control the spread of fire and minimize damage. By incorporating these systems into the design and construction of buildings, stakeholders can improve the overall fire safety of the building and protect both occupants and property.
